All icon themes are WinterBoard themes. So they should work in iOS4. Am I going to redo >2000 icons for the retina display? I don't think that is doable.
As to the LockInfo html theme, it will crash and boot into safe mode. This is not a problem of my theme (it's all valid html). The problem appears to be WinterBoard as it won't load html themes for the lockscreen.
